NEC’s major blow: star defender Jacob Okao ruled out for the season

NEC FC have been dealt a massive setback early in the 2025/26 Uganda Premier League campaign after influential centre-back Jacob Okao was ruled out for the remainder of the season with a serious injury.

The club confirmed that the dependable defender ruptured his Achilles tendon during NEC’s 2-2 draw with Police FC at Lugogo on Friday — a devastating blow that came just two games into the new campaign.

“He’s expected to be out for 6–12 months as he begins his recovery journey,” the club announced on Monday.

The injury means Okao is unlikely to feature again this season, with the league scheduled to conclude around May or June 2026.

Fortunately, there is a silver lining for both the player and the club, the surgery was successfully conducted at Case Clinic under the FUFA Medical Insurance Scheme.

Huge void at the back

Okao’s absence leaves a gaping hole in NEC’s backline. The centre-back has been one of the team’s most consistent and reliable performers since their promotion to the top flight.

He was ever-present last season, anchoring NEC’s defence across all competitions — the Uganda Premier League, Uganda Cup, Super 8, and the CAF Confederation Cup. His commanding presence, leadership, and composure at the back were key pillars in NEC’s impressive performances.

Okao’s stellar contributions earned him the club’s Most Valuable Player (MVP) award for the 2024/25 season, capping off what was a breakout year for the young defender.

Defensive keystone

With Okao marshalling the defence, NEC enjoyed one of the best defensive records in the league, conceding just 19 goals in 30 matches, the joint second-best defensive tally behind champions Vipers SC, who let in only 15.

NEC’s remarkable run saw them finish second on the 16-team table with 67 points — only two shy of Vipers’ title-winning 69. Alongside Vipers and BUL, NEC also suffered the fewest defeats (3) throughout the season, losing only to Vipers, SC Villa, and Express.

Okao’s injury now forces the Die Hards to rethink their defensive shape as they aim to build on last season’s historic campaign. Replacing his consistency and calm under pressure will be no easy task, and his absence will undoubtedly be felt as the season progresses.
